Broaden genre exposure

Collaborating with artists from different genres allows musicians to experiment with new sounds and styles, which can attract listeners who may not typically engage with their primary genre. For example, a rock band collaborating with a hip-hop artist can create a unique fusion that introduces rock fans to hip-hop elements and vice versa.

This genre blending can lead to innovative music that stands out in a crowded market, making it easier for artists to gain recognition and appeal to a wider audience.

Attract diverse fan bases

When artists collaborate, they bring their respective fan bases together, creating an opportunity to reach new listeners. For instance, a local folk singer partnering with an electronic music producer can draw in fans from both genres, expanding their overall audience.

To maximize this effect, artists should promote their collaborations through social media and local events, encouraging fans from both sides to engage with the new music and each other.

Increase streaming numbers

Collaborative tracks often perform better on streaming platforms due to the combined promotional efforts and the appeal of multiple artists. This can lead to increased plays and shares, which are crucial for gaining visibility in algorithms that favor popular content.

Artists should consider releasing collaborative singles or EPs on platforms like Spotify or Apple Music, as these can generate buzz and attract listeners looking for fresh content.

Boost live event attendance

Live performances featuring collaborations can draw larger crowds, as fans from different genres come together to see their favorite artists. This can be particularly effective for local music festivals or joint concerts, where diverse lineups attract a wider audience.

To enhance attendance, artists should promote these events through targeted marketing strategies, such as social media campaigns and partnerships with local venues, ensuring the collaboration is highlighted to both fan bases.

SoundCloud

SoundCloud is a popular platform for music sharing and collaboration, allowing artists to upload their tracks and receive feedback from listeners and fellow musicians. Users can comment on specific parts of a track, facilitating targeted discussions and collaboration opportunities.

To collaborate on SoundCloud, artists can use the platform’s “Repost” feature to share each other’s work, which helps in reaching wider audiences. Consider joining groups focused on your genre to find potential collaborators and share your music with like-minded individuals.

BandLab

BandLab is a cloud-based platform designed specifically for music creation and collaboration. It offers tools for recording, mixing, and sharing music, making it easy for artists to work together remotely. The platform supports real-time collaboration, allowing multiple users to edit a project simultaneously.

With features like virtual instruments and a built-in social network, BandLab encourages creativity and interaction among musicians. Artists can also publish their work directly to the platform, gaining exposure to a community eager for new sounds.
